Position Summary
We're hiring a Senior Full Stack Developer with hands-on fintech/payments experience to build secure web applications and transaction workflows. You'll deliver a QR payment solution for Pakistan and work on banking/fintech projects including merchant onboarding, KYC/AML, reconciliation, and risk controls.
Key Responsibilities
- Build responsive fintech web apps (React/Next preferred) and secure backend APIs (Node.js/Python)
- Design API contracts and data models for QR payments, transfers, settlements, refunds, and chargebacks
- Integrate with payment gateways and banks; implement webhooks, idempotency, and signature verification
- Implement compliance-first data handling: KYC/AML checks, RBAC, audit logs, access controls
- Design double-entry ledger models; build reconciliation pipelines and financial reporting
- Implement fraud/risk controls: anomaly detection, velocity limits, device trust, and alerting
- Collaborate with data/AI teams to productize risk insights with safety checks and fallbacks
- Deliver maintainable, well-tested code with documentation for audits and compliance reviews
Required Skills and Qualifications
- Fintech/Payments Experience: 3+ years building fintech or payment applications (gateways, wallets, or bank integrations)
- Full-Stack Experience: 6+ years full-stack development in product/startup environments
- Frontend: React.js/Next.js (preferred) or similar modern frameworks
- Backend: Node.js (Express/Nest) or Python (FastAPI/Django/Flask)
- Payments Literacy: Understanding of QR payments (EMVCo static/dynamic), reconciliation, settlement cycles, disputes/chargebacks
- APIs & Integration: REST/GraphQL, third-party integrations, webhooks, idempotency, signature/HMAC verification
- Databases: Postgres/MySQL; strong SQL; data modeling for ledgers and reconciliation
- Security/Compliance: PCI-DSS fundamentals, encryption in transit/at rest, tokenization, and audit trails
- AI Integration: Experience integrating risk scoring, anomaly detection, or fraud signals into payment workflows
Nice-to-Have Skills
- Regional Payments: Experience with Pakistan/regional payment rails (EMVCo QR, local bank APIs)
- Open Banking & Cards: Banking APIs, card acquiring, 3DS flows, deep links, device binding
- Financial Architectures: Event-driven systems (Kafka/NATS), outbox/inbox patterns, CQRS/event sourcing basics
- Financial Operations: Ledger engines, automated reconciliation, settlements, and financial reporting
- DevOps for Fintech: Docker, CI/CD, cloud security, observability (metrics/logs/traces)
- Financial Standards: ISO 8583/20022 familiarity; Pakistan regulatory knowledge (advantage)
- Risk & Compliance: Fraud detection systems, AML compliance workflows, regulatory reporting
Compensation & Benefits
- Competitive salary package (negotiable based on experience and skills)
- Professional development budget for courses, conferences, tools
- Quarterly performance bonuses based on individual and company performance
- Equity consideration for exceptional candidates who demonstrate strong culture fit
- Remote-friendly, flexible working hours with high-performance hardware and tools
- Opportunity to work on cutting-edge fintech and payment innovation projects
How to Apply:
Submit your CV/Portfolio at hr@xyric.ai
Job Type: Full-time
Application Question(s):
- What are your Current & Expected Salary benefits?
Work Location: In person